SPOTLIGHT REVIEW
Sound: This is a very flexible pedal. It creates anything from a mild blues overdrive effect to a solid crunch, all without losing any toneal qualities. For the price, this is the best pedal on the market! Feature: Effectvely, this is two seperate, high quality pedals. For those wishing to make a crisp, clear solo or a warm lower end crunch, this is a wondreful pedal. Like everything else, though, it has its limitations. If you are looking for something to take you completely over the edge for the heavy metal, grunge or punk sounds, look elsewhere. Quality: Withstands punishment well. Very durable. No worries on wear and tear. High quality materials. Value: I dig this pedal. It's amazing that it is sold at such a low price, because this is the best pedal for its price! Manufacturer Support: Ibanez has a well-deserved reputation for good support. I have no experience with them with this particular pedal because it is made so well. The Wow Factor: I'm not a big fan of silver. The lines are simple, and could be made more appealing by rounding edges and making the footswitch and controls more integrated into the body, as opposed to being additions that create a temporary or fragile appearance. Overall: I chose this product for its ability to maintain the integrity of its tones even when really crunching or popping solos. It is remarkably flexible in what it can do, and easy to determine what it cannot. If you want to go beyond the crunch that this can produce, then buy something specifically designed for that purpose to supplement this pedal. In concert with other pedals and effects, the range that this unit can produce is unbeatable. On its own, it is one of the best for doing what it is designed for.

"TS-7 vs. the TS-9, you make the call..." submitted February 7, 2006

By a customer from yahoo.com
Overall
Sound
Features
Quality
Value
Manufacturer Support
The Wow Factor
Musical Background: Active Musician
Music Style: blues, jazz
Back to Product Information
Sound: At first, I was dubious about how this version of the tubescreamer would sound due to its low cost. All it took was plugging this bad boy in to dispel those feelings! This pedal is every bit as responsive to my playing, as my TS-9, and then some. Its "hot" feature really gives it a warm, overdriven amp sound, almost akin to an arbiter fuzz face. I played it side by side my TS-9 and I honestly couldn't hear a difference. I know alot of purists might think this is crap, but if you have the opportunity to do this test for yourself, you'll see what I mean. As far as the cost goes, I don't know why the TS-7 costs so little, but I'm not complaining! I think this little pedal is even better than the Boss Blues Driver pedal, and I played them side by side as well to prove it. Feature: Very durable; I really like the fact that the knobs can be pushed into the body of the pedal. Quality: Very tough, and road worthy. I'm retiring my TS-9 and using this bad boy on every gig. Value: I can't believe how affordable this pedal is. Worth every penny, and more. Manufacturer Support: Ibanez just keeps getting better, and they never fail to surprise me. I've contacted them in the past for previous purchases, and they have always been very helpful. The Wow Factor: It's sleek, charcoal grey exteriour really catches they eye when compared to the "rainbow" of fruit flavors most other pedals offer. It feels solid when you stomp on it, and it's simple design is really user friendly. Overall: I've only had this pedal a month, but It hasn't let me down in the five gigs I've had so far. If this thing is every bit as reliable as it's forefathers that I own, I look forward to owning this little overdrive pedal for a long, long time.
